Output bbbf04ad29adf77fefd0e1b4f882357744aca0f6ec0f4b4a2d45feb65eb0fbf3:1

value
23208677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85c1408541338f05c5db3dbef523ff7c2fd4300d OP_EQUAL
address
3DtFJShSKwzfwCbbWQeroAbMvV7oPXYVGT
transaction
bbbf04ad29adf77fefd0e1b4f882357744aca0f6ec0f4b4a2d45feb65eb0fbf3
confirmations
369762
spent
true